Unauthorized Driving As the threat of theft of cars becomes more frequent, car owners are seeking ways to increase their security. One of the most popular options is a ghost immobiliser, that stops your vehicle from starting until you enter a unique PIN sequence. This technology can prevent your vehicle from being copied by thieves, a different method they employ to steal cars. Ghost immobilisers are different from traditional immobilisers which use transponders and key fobs. They connect directly to the CAN data network of your vehicle and require you to enter a PIN to start the vehicle. The system is virtually invisible and operates in a silent manner and makes it much more difficult for thieves to interfere with or disable the device. It's also not affected by spoofing or signal jamming devices that boost the signal that is sent to your car. While Ghost Immobilisers are a formidable barrier against vehicle theft However, it's important to keep in mind that no security system is 100% secure. Even the most sophisticated systems are susceptible to being hacked by savvy thieves, which is why you should be extra vigilant to avoid theft of your vehicle. This includes securing your keys and parking in areas that are well-lit.
